How the formula works
Both pound per cubic inch and dram per fluid ounce measure the same physical quantity (mass per unit volume), so converting between them is a single multiplication. Multiply a value in pound per cubic inch by 462 to get dram per fluid ounce. To reverse the conversion, multiply a dram per fluid ounce value by 0.002165 to get back to pound per cubic inch.
